Cilantro Lime Pasta Salad Ingredients
For the Salad
- Bow Tie Pasta (16 oz) – This is the base of the salad; any short pasta like rotini works well.
- Corn Kernels (1½ cups) – Adds a sweet and crunchy element; fresh corn is best, but canned or frozen can work in a pinch.
- Cherry Tomatoes (1½ cups, halved) – Bring juicy bursts of flavor; feel free to swap with grape tomatoes if needed.
- Red Onion (½, chopped or thinly sliced) – Provides a milder sweetness compared to other onion varieties.
- Cilantro (2 Tbsp, finely chopped) – Enhances the overall flavor; don’t forget to use both leaves and stems for maximum taste.
- Avocados (1-2, diced) – Essential for that creamy texture; cut them fresh to prevent browning.
- Cotija Cheese (optional) – Adds a salty, creamy layer; you can substitute with feta cheese if desired.
For the Dressing
- Plain Greek Yogurt (½ cup) – Serves as a creamy base for the dressing; omit for a lighter option or substitute with sour cream.
- Fresh Lime Juice (¼ cup) – Offers a tangy kick; adjust according to your taste preferences.
- Cilantro (¼ cup, roughly chopped) – Adds an extra layer of herbaceous flavor.
- Garlic Cloves (2) – Provides depth to the dressing; no need to mince!
- Salt (½ tsp) & Cayenne Pepper (⅛ tsp) – Perfect for seasoning; feel free to adjust these amounts to suit your palate.

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Cilantro Lime Pasta Salad
Step 1: Prepare the Dressing
In a food processor, blend ½ cup of plain Greek yogurt, ¼ cup of fresh lime juice, ¼ cup of roughly chopped cilantro, and 2 unminced garlic cloves until smooth. Season with ½ teaspoon of salt and ⅛ teaspoon of cayenne pepper, adjusting to your taste. Once combined, refrigerate the dressing for about 30 minutes to allow the flavors to meld while you prepare the salad components.
Step 2: Cook the Pasta
Bring a large pot of salted water to a rolling boil. Add 16 ounces of bow tie pasta and cook according to package instructions until al dente, usually around 8-10 minutes. Once cooked, drain the pasta in a colander and rinse it under cold water to stop the cooking process. Set it aside to cool completely, ensuring it’s at room temperature before combining with the salad.
Step 3: Prep the Veggies
While your pasta cools, prepare the salad ingredients. In a small saucepan, bring water to a boil and cook 1½ cups of corn kernels for 1½ to 2 minutes. Immediately remove from heat and drain. Once rinsed, chop 1½ cups of cherry tomatoes in half, and finely chop ½ of a red onion and 2 tablespoons of cilantro. With all veggies prepped, you’re ready to assemble the refreshing Cilantro Lime Pasta Salad.
Step 4: Combine the Salad
In a large mixing bowl, combine the cooled pasta, cooked corn, cherry tomatoes, chopped onion, and cilantro. Stir gently to mix the ingredients evenly. As you combine, admire the vibrant colors! Then, pour the chilled dressing over the salad mixture and toss everything together until well-coated, ensuring each bite is bursting with flavor.
Step 5: Serve and Garnish
Before serving your Cilantro Lime Pasta Salad, dice 1-2 ripe avocados and fold them gently into the salad. If desired, sprinkle with cotija cheese for an additional creamy and salty element. Serve immediately for the freshest taste at summer picnics, or chill for up to an hour before serving to enhance the flavors. Enjoy this delightful dish that embodies the essence of summer!

Make Ahead Options
These Cilantro Lime Pasta Salad ingredients are perfect for meal prep, allowing you to save time during busy days! You can prepare the dressing and pasta up to 24 hours in advance. Simply blend the dressing (Greek yogurt, lime juice, cilantro, garlic, salt, and cayenne) and refrigerate it to let the flavors develop. Cook the pasta, rinse it, and store it in an airtight container in the fridge. For the freshest taste, chop the veggies (corn, tomatoes, onion, cilantro) ahead of time and combine them during assembly. Just before serving, toss everything together and add diced avocado (to prevent browning). This way, you’ll have a delicious, refreshing Cilantro Lime Pasta Salad ready in no time!
How to Store and Freeze Cilantro Lime Pasta Salad
Fridge: Store in an airtight container for up to 2-3 days to maintain freshness. Be sure to keep the avocado separate if you’ve already added it, as it can brown quickly.
Freezer: While it’s best enjoyed fresh, you can freeze the salad without the avocado and dressing for up to 1 month. Thaw it in the fridge overnight before serving.
Prep Ahead: To save time, prep all ingredients a day in advance, storing them separately. Combine everything right before serving for the best taste and texture.
Reheating: Enjoy this salad chilled or at room temperature. If you prefer to warm it slightly, avoid microwaving as it can change the texture; instead, let it sit out for 15-20 minutes before serving.

Cilantro Lime Pasta Salad Recipe FAQs
What type of pasta should I use for Cilantro Lime Pasta Salad?
I recommend using bow tie pasta for its fun shape, but any short pasta like rotini or fusilli will work perfectly. Just make sure to cook it al dente, as it helps maintain a pleasant texture when mixed with the salad ingredients.
How should I store leftover Cilantro Lime Pasta Salad?
Store the salad in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 2-3 days. If you’ve added avocado, it’s best to keep it separate to prevent browning. Just toss the avocado in right before serving!
Can I freeze Cilantro Lime Pasta Salad?
Absolutely! However, it’s best to freeze the salad without the avocado or dressing. You can store it in a freezer-safe container for up to 1 month. Before serving, thaw it in the fridge overnight and reassemble with fresh avocado and dressing.
What can I do if my dressing is too tart?
If you find that your dressing is a bit too tangy for your liking, try adding a teaspoon of honey or maple syrup. This little touch of sweetness can help balance out the acidity of the lime juice for a smoother flavor profile.
Are there any allergy considerations for this recipe?
Yes, this salad is vegetarian but contains dairy from the Greek yogurt and cotija cheese. If anyone has dairy allergies or intolerances, you can easily substitute the yogurt with a plant-based option and skip the cheese for a delicious vegan variation.
What’s the best way to prepare this salad ahead of time?
To save time, you can prep all the ingredients the night before. Cook the pasta, chop the veggies, and prepare the dressing, storing each individually in the fridge. Then, combine everything just before serving. This way, you’ll maintain the freshness and crunch of the salad!
